The Salvation Army is one of Australia's largest and most-loved charities, helping thousands of Australians every year find hope in the midst of all kinds of personal hardship.

The Salvation Army offers the opportunity to use your professional skills and expertise to make a real difference in the lives of people who need help most.


  • The Salvation Army Youth Services offer an integrated suite of programs engaging with young people across Australia. Our services create intentional avenues for young people to explore opportunities, build support networks, and access, participate and contribute to their communities.


Youth services provide a diverse range of programs which include housing and homelessness, driver training, education, employment and training, AOD support, social and community activities, specialist therapeutic responses and youth justice programs.


We are seeking a values-driven and dedicated Food Service Assistant to provide high-level planning, implementation, delivery and recording of all aspects of the food delivery of the ELC service.

This is a permanent part-time 15 hours per week position based at Balga Corps.

You will successfully

  • Compliance to highest standards of food safety legislation to vulnerable persons (aged 5yrs and under)
  • Provide a varied, balanced meal plan for a range of ages, dietary, religious and medical needs
  • Understand, comply and adhere to food safety protocols, policy and process
  • Manage the early years' kitchen including storage, cleaning and stock rotation
You will have

  • Certificate III in Food Service
  • 12 months experience in a similar role is desired
  • A valid Employee Working with Children Check
  • A willingness to undergo a National Police Check
